Which cells build or replace bone tissue?

Explanation:
The main concept is bone formation by specialized cells that synthesize and deposit new bone tissue. Osteoblasts are the bone-forming cells. They produce the organic matrix (osteoid), primarily collagen, and then promote mineralization to convert that matrix into hard bone. As they lay down new bone, they help replace old tissue during growth, remodeling, and fracture repair. Some osteoblasts become osteocytes embedded within the bone to help maintain it, while others become lining cells on the bone surface. Osteoclasts, by contrast, resorb bone, breaking it down rather than building it up.
